She's started a home tour series and the focus this week is kitchens. Our kitchen is probably one of my favorite rooms in the house.  Since I love to cook and bake, it's where I spend most of my time.  When we moved in just over two year ago, the kitchen is the room that needed the most work.  We made a list of everything we wanted to do and one by one started checking things off the list. Most of our accents are red and we've incorporated a lot of wine into the decor. 

 Here is what our kitchen looked like when we moved in...


 Laminate floors, accent wall, wallpaper border, formica countertops,  white appliances, etc.  



Here is a picture of the kitchen not too long after the move.  We picked an coffee color for the walls and red accents.  I love the wine bottle holders on the left, which were from Crate and Barrel.  


One of our big purchases was granite countertops.  And what a difference they made.  Shortly after was all new appliances in black.  Things were starting to come together...



Our kitchen overlooks our living room.  



A year ago my dad put in tile floors.  This definitely brought the entire room together and was the last big thing to check off our list.
